How they compare
Panama currently reports 23.9 against 23.59 in Nepal, a difference of 0.31.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Panama has been ahead every year.
Nepal ranks 17th and Panama ranks 14th of 147 countries.
Panama has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Nepal | Panama |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 42.92 | 56.83 | 13.92 | Panama |
| 2020s | 28.23 | 33.06 | 4.83 | Panama |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
